They, that is to say Socks and the leader of the other leftist party keeping him in power, have been floating some ideas such as easing mail in ballot conditions as well as changing the method as to how we vote.

To be clear, here's how we vote both provincially and federally.

We apply for and get mailed to our address a Voter ID card.

That card tells us which polling station we can vote at, as well as which table within the polling station we'll be voting at.

On election day we present said card and they can ask for photo ID at this point too.

The last election before I went to the table I would vote at, they scanned the mailed to me Voter ID card which then meant it was done - couldn't be used by anyone else or me again.

There's a register at the table with my name and address listed, and upon signing my name beside that, I'm given a paper ballot and a pencil.

We walk behind a cardboard shield, make our mark on who we vote for, fold the ballot in half and place it in a box as we walk out from behind the shield.

There are scrutineers watching both that I've only been issued one paper ballot and that I've folded it correctly before placing it into the box.

The same scrutineers, usually from several parties, open the boxes after the polls close, count the ballots and submit the numbers.

I have personally witnessed people not being allowed to vote because they were at the wrong polling station and had the wherewithal to still make it to the correct one.

Also I've seen a lady denied because she didn't have the correct photo ID or a Voter ID card.

Overall it's a fairly decent system from what I can gather.
